A
Andrea Levenson Review of Wewatchweb
I recently tried a website to keep track of my onl...
I recently tried a website to keep track of my online presence. It was a wonderful experience. The platform is user-friendly and I was able to easily monitor my progress. Highly recommended for those who want to improve their online presence!

Comments: